摘 要:针对超深井短轻尾管悬挂及丢手判断难度大的问题,进行短轻尾管悬挂、丢手判断关键技术分析研究。以塔河油田超深井短轻尾管作业实践为基础,进行理论分析和经验总结,提出短轻尾管范畴,引入顶升力影响因素,形成了以“上提悬挂,下压丢手”为原则、理论计算实测跟踪为手段、多方面考虑多角度验证为保障等一系列技术方案。将超深井短轻尾管悬挂、丢手判断数据化、规范化。应用表明,该技术方案具有易操作、低风险的优点,可有效解决超深井短轻尾管悬挂及丢手判断难的问题,对超深、复杂地层的油气开发具有参考意义,值得进一步优化及推广应用。In view of the judging difficulties in hanging and releasing short-light liner in ultra-deep well,analysis has been carried out on the key technique of hanging and releasing in short-light liner operation.Based on the practice of short-light liner cementing in the ultra-deep well of Tahe Oilfield,the theory analysis and experience summary were carried out,and the category of short-light liner was proposed,and the influencing factors of top-lift were introduced.In this paper,a series of technical solutions are formed such as the lift-hanging and press-releasing,theoretical calculation of measured tracking as a means,and multi-angle verification as a guarantee.The data of the short-light liner in ultra-deep well is analyzed and standardized.Field application shows that this method has the advantages of easy operation and low risk,which provides technical support for short-light liner work,and guidance for ultradeep,complex for mation of oil-gas development and is worth further optimization and application.
